Titan Tool Supply Inc. announces its line of TFS4-720 model articulating borescopes. The new borescopes offer a high-resolution, 17,000-element optical fiber imaging bundle and feature an objective end tip that can be deflected + 120 degrees in either two-way or four-way articulation by using a control knob next to the eyepiece housing. This lets the user position the borescope for viewing around elbows and bends in the work piece. TFBS-6 Series borescopes have a direct photo adaptable "C" mount, enabling connection to an industrial video camera without the need for an additional video coupler. The tungsten braid sheathing offers better protection and abrasion-resistance than standard sheathing. TFBS-6 borescopes have a diameter of 0.236 inch (6mm), minimum bend radius of 1.5 inch (38mm), 20X magnification, 50 degree field of view, and depth of field from 0.18 inch to 3 inches (5- to 75mm). Maximum operating temperature is 200 F (90 C). Each model is supplied with a 1W LED handle for illumination. For more information call (716) 873-9907 or visit www.TitanTool.com.
